    Motor vehicle insurance law can differ from one state to another. This is the reason why car owners must carefully study the rules imposed in their states of residence because otherwise, they may be penalized for violations they were not aware of. A basic rule applied by most states, however, is that car owners must purchase a third-party liability policy.
